Skip to content

Commit c83af84

Browse files
committed
Bump LLVM and Clang in dev shell
1 parent 629eaa6 commit c83af84

File tree

1 file changed

+12
-27
lines changed

1 file changed

+12
-27
lines changed

shell.nix

+12-27
Original file line numberDiff line numberDiff line change
@@ -4,55 +4,40 @@
44
}:
55

66
let
7-
#unstablePkgs = import (fetchTarball "https://github.com/NixOS/nixpkgs/archive/nixpkgs-unstable.tar.gz") {};
7+
#unstablePkgs = import (fetchTarball "https://github.com/NixOS/nixpkgs/archive/nixpkgs-unstable.tar.gz") {};
88
in
99
pkgs.mkShell {
1010
buildInputs = [
1111
# GStreamer
1212
pkgs.gst_all_1.gstreamer
13-
pkgs.gst_all_1.gstreamer.dev
1413
pkgs.gst_all_1.gst-rtsp-server
15-
pkgs.gst_all_1.gst-rtsp-server.dev
1614
pkgs.gst_all_1.gst-plugins-ugly # For x264enc element
1715
pkgs.gst_all_1.gst-plugins-bad # For intervideo* elements
1816
pkgs.gst_all_1.gst-plugins-base
1917
pkgs.gst_all_1.gst-plugins-good
2018
pkgs.gst_all_1.gst-libav # For avenc_aac
2119
pkgs.gst_all_1.gst-vaapi
2220

23-
pkgs.llvmPackages_14.llvm
24-
pkgs.llvmPackages_14.clang
25-
pkgs.llvmPackages_14.lldb
26-
pkgs.llvmPackages_14.lld
27-
pkgs.clang-tools_14
28-
29-
# GNUstep
30-
pkgs.gnustep.base
31-
pkgs.gnustep.make
32-
33-
pkgs.glib
34-
pkgs.glib.dev
35-
pkgs.gobject-introspection
21+
pkgs.clang_18
22+
pkgs.lldb_18
23+
pkgs.clang-tools_18
3624
pkgs.meson
3725
pkgs.pkg-config
3826
pkgs.ninja
3927

40-
# vaapi (vainfo)
41-
pkgs.libva-utils
28+
# GNUstep
29+
pkgs.gnustep.base
30+
pkgs.gnustep.make
4231

4332
pkgs.graphviz
44-
4533
pkgs.udev
46-
pkgs.udev.dev
47-
48-
# MicroHTTPKit
49-
pkgs.microhttpkit
50-
5134
pkgs.libdispatch
52-
53-
# MicroHTTPKit Dev (TODO: Move into Libraries/nix)
54-
pkgs.libmicrohttpd
35+
pkgs.microhttpkit
36+
pkgs.glib
5537
pkgs.xctest
38+
39+
# vaapi (vainfo)
40+
pkgs.libva-utils
5641
];
5742

5843
shellHook = ''

0 commit comments

Comments
 (0)